Delicious Gluten-Free Strawberry Shortcake Recipe – Easy & Fresh!

This gluten-free strawberry shortcake recipe is light, buttery, and bursting with fresh berries. It features flaky homemade gluten-free biscuits layered with juicy strawberries and fluffy whipped cream. Perfect for spring, summer, or any time you want a fresh and simple dessert everyone can enjoy!

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ale

🍰 For the Biscuits:

2 cups gluten-free all-purpose flour (with xanthan gum)

1 tbsp baking powder

1/4 tsp baking soda

1/4 tsp salt

2 tbsp granulated sugar

1/2 cup cold unsalted butter, cut into cubes

3/4 cup buttermilk (or use milk + 1 tsp lemon juice)

1 tsp vanilla extract

🍓 For the Strawberries:

1 lb fresh strawberries, hulled and sliced

23 tbsp granulated sugar

1 tsp lemon juice

🥄 For the Whipped Cream:

1 cup heavy cream

2 tbsp powdered sugar

1/2 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

1. In a medium bowl, toss sliced strawberries with sugar and lemon juice. Set aside to macerate at room temperature (about 30 minutes).

2.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

3.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and sugar.

4. Cut in the cold butter using a pastry cutter or your fingers until pea-sized crumbs form.

5. Mix buttermilk and vanilla together. Add to dry ingredients and stir until dough just comes together.

6. Turn dough onto a floured surface. Pat into a 1-inch thick round. Cut into 6 biscuits using a biscuit cutter or glass.

7. Place biscuits on baking sheet and bake 13–15 minutes or until golden.

8. Let biscuits cool slightly on a rack.

9. Meanwhile, whip c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la until soft peaks form.

10. To serve: Slice biscuits in half. Spoon strawberries over the bottom half, top with whipped cream, and cover with biscuit top. Add more cream and berries if desired.

Notes

Make dairy-free by using plant-based butter and coconut cream.

Best enjoyed the day it’s made but biscuits can be frozen and reheated.

Use other berries like blueberries or raspberries for a twist!
